  • Tarun Tahiliani defends Paris Olympics uniforms amid backlash: 'didn't aim for haute couture'

    Male athletes wore a white kurta and Bundi jacket adorned with orange and green naksi work, celebrating the Indian tricolour. Female athletes donned ikat-inspired sarees in the tricolours of white, orange, and green.

  • 'Eyesore': Internet not happy with Tarun Tahiliani, his designs for Indian team at Paris Olympics

    The uniforms consisted of white kurta pajamas for male athletes, paired with jackets featuring the saffron and green of the Indian tricolour. Female athletes wore sarees. The revelation that Tarun Tahiliani, a renowned designer, was behind the uniforms surprised and angered many.

  • Textile Conclave 2013 - Part VI

    The Indian clothing industry holds an important position in the Indian economy. This sector has been growing at a CAGR of 10 percent from Rs 126000 crore in the FY07 to Rs 202600 crore in FY13.
